This post compares Alameda, California to Livermore,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Alameda (city) Livermore (city)
Population 78,246 88,232
Income (median) $71,080 $75,750
Home Value (median) $729,100 $643,200
White 48% 78%
Black 7% 1%
Asian 31% 10%
With Kids 31% 36%
Age (median) 41 39
Rentals 53% 28%
